DOCUMENT:Q71136 08-DEC-1999 [win95x] TITLE :Upper Tray Option on Toshiba Pagelaser12 Setup Doesn't Work PRODUCT :Microsoft Windows 95.x Retail Product PROD/VER:WINDOWS:3.0,3.0a OPER/SYS: KEYWORDS: ====================================================================== ------------------------------------------------------------------------------- The information in this article applies to: - Microsoft Windows versions 3.0, 3.0a ------------------------------------------------------------------------------- SYMPTOMS ======== The Hewlett-Packard (HP) LaserJet driver (HPPCL.DRV) version 3.4, included with the Windows Supplemental Driver Library, supports the Toshiba Pagelaser12 Printer. However, if you do the following, the printer defaults back to Auto Select: 1. From the Control Panel, select Printers. 2. Select the desired printer and choose Configure. 3. Select the appropriate port and choose Setup. 4. In the Paper Source field, select Upper Tray. 5. Choose OK. STATUS ====== Microsoft is researching this problem and will post new information here as it becomes available.
